Hi after the import of my latest photos, Lightroom Classic every time restarts the screen with import (where you select the source and the photos that you want to import). I tried already to restart my pc, I deinstalled Lightroom classic (twice). I have the Lightroom Classic 15.0.1 with windows 11 (latest updates have been done). I have more than enough space, so no crash there. Does anyone has an idea?

Do you have a memory card or a removable source connected to your computer when you start LrC?  SD card? CFExpress? CF? USB Flash drive, Camera?

 

And look at /preferences/general/import options/
